Key Responsibilities 

  • Contribute significantly to critical system design decisions, helping to architect data solutions that support real-time workloads.
  • Partner with cross-functional teams to translate intricate business needs into effective and innovative data solutions.
  • Mentor and provide expert technical guidance to junior engineers, fostering a culture of continuous learning and growth.
  • Design data systems to solve problems and improve reliability & cost-effectiveness. 
  • Develop and maintain robust, secure integrations with core internal systems and critical third-party platforms. 
  • Implement advanced monitoring and alerting, to ensure high system reliability and minimal downtime. 

Skills, Knowledge and Experience 

  • You have expert-level proficiency in a core programming language like Python, Java, or Scala, with an emphasis on AI/ML data processing.
  • You possess experience with cloud data services and technologies, ideally within the GCP ecosystem (e.g., Dataflow, Pub/Sub, BigQuery, Vertex AI).
  • Experience with Airflow environment management and Docker 
  • You can clearly and concisely explain intricate technical concepts to both technical and non-technical stakeholders.
  • You have extensive experience designing and optimising both real-time and large-scale batch data processing frameworks.
  • You have a proven ability to deploy and maintain data infrastructure using Infrastructure as Code (IaC) principles with tools like Terraform.
  • You can demonstrate the application of data governance, privacy, and security best practices in a regulated environment.
  • You are a proactive and curious problem-solver, skilled in anticipating and resolving system inefficiencies.
  • You work seamlessly with cross-functional teams, translating complex requirements into robust data solutions.
  • You take full responsibility for the quality, reliability, and performance of the data solutions you help create.
